State of Alaska Department of Revenue Has $7.60 Million Position in Northrop Grumman Corporation $NOC

State of Alaska Department of Revenue trimmed its position in Northrop Grumman Corporation (NYSE:NOCFree Report) by 4.6% in the second quarter, according to its most recent filing with the SEC. The fund owned 15,196 shares of the aerospace company’s stock after selling 740 shares during the period. State of Alaska Department of Revenue’s holdings in Northrop Grumman were worth $7,597,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Northrop Grumman (NYSE:NOCG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, July 22nd. The aerospace company reported $7.11 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$6.84 by $0.27. Northrop Grumman had a net margin of 9.74% and a return on equity of 25.52%. The company had revenue of $10.35 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$10.15 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company earned $6.36 earnings per share.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 1.3% on a year-over-year basis. Northrop Grumman has set its FY 2025 guidance at 25.000-25.400 EPS. Equities research analysts anticipate that Northrop Grumman Corporation will post 28.05 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Northrop Grumman Profile

(Free Report)

Northrop Grumman Corporation operates as an aerospace and defense technology company in the United States, Asia/Pacific, Europe, and internationally. The company’s Aeronautics Systems segment designs, develops, manufactures, integrates, and sustains aircraft systems. This segment also offers unmanned autonomous aircraft systems, including high-altitude long-endurance strategic ISR systems and vertical take-off and landing tactical ISR systems; and strategic long-range strike aircraft, tactical fighter and air dominance aircraft, and airborne battle management and command and control systems.
